My way of doing twitter but on hive,

  • I would post all 'tweets' to comments of a post by the dapp account, A new post is made once a day. (for upvotes to help support the dapp and so the comments on one post don't get too messy)
  • any replys would be children of said comments,
  • Comments give lower rewards there for you can't complain about shortform getting huge rewards.
  • I'd make a front end that would format these comments into 'tweets' and associated replys in a readable way.
  • All replys and 'tweets' can be upvoted.
  • No one would generally see the spam unless they specifically looked at the Dapps posts containing all the comments.

At the end of the day the idea is to store the 'tweet' on hive while having a frontend to properly display them as short form content.
Character limits would apply similar to twitter for cross posting potential.
I'd find a way so that any posts or comments made outside of our own front end would be filtered out if not following correct posting format etc.
